CFDs

CFD trading is an excellent way to gain exposure to the financial markets and benefit from short-term price movements. CFDs, or Contracts For Difference, are flexible investment instruments that allow traders to speculate on the price movements of a variety of assets, such as indices, commodities, stocks, and currency pairs. CFDs can be traded with leverage and traders can go both long and short, offering an alternative to traditional financial trading. By taking a position on CFDs, traders can benefit from the changes in market prices and speculate on rising or falling markets, without owning the underlying asset. CFD trading is suitable for both experienced and novice traders and offers access to some of the world’s most popular markets.

History Origins & Importance of Forex Trading

Forex, one of the oldest financial markets in the world, has been a means of exchanging one currency for another since the Babylonians first began trading monetary commodities over 4,000 years ago. The history of the forex market has evolved over time to become one of the largest and most dynamic markets in the world. It has evolved from the interbank market, where transactions between large banks and financial institutions take place, to the retail trading market, where individual traders and investors now have the ability to participate and capitalize on market movements. Due to the sheer size and global impact of the forex market, it is an important asset class for traders and investors. The liquidity, scalability, and highly volatile nature of the forex market makes it an important financial instrument for traders, as they can easily capitalize on short-term movements and take advantage of large market trends. Therefore, understanding the history of forex, its origins, and its importance to the financial world is essential for any individual looking to participate in the forex market.
